Kimberley's Underground Mining Railway est une attraction touristique unique située au 111 Gerry Sorensen Way, Kimberley, BC V1A 2Y5, Canada. Cette entreprise propose une expérience immersive dans l'histoire de la mine de Sullivan et de la technologie minière dans la région de Kimberley. We have an amazing tour at this mine, you start the tour on a train, the same train they used to transport the miner's, once in the mine you get a close-up demonstration of how the mine workes by one of the original miners, he demonstrated some of the equipment so you saw and heard how hard the work was, after the mine you get to see the power house, this was where the air that powered all the equipment was made. One of the best two hours you can spend in Kimberly. From the moment we were buying the tickets, the reception lady was the most adorable welcoming person ever. She told us a brief history of the mining in Kimberly.
The tour was so exciting. The tour guide was a former miner and such a friendly gentleman. Absolutely recommended.

Tip for the tour: dress properly. You are going to the mine, get out of the train and tour around. The weather in the mine is freezing. Have a jacket with you. Even is hot summer! The floor is wet (like come on, you go to a mine. What do you expect?). Don’t go there with flip flops. Your toes will get muddy and wet.
